What happened The credit-card company posted higher sales and profit in the second quarter, thanks to higher spending among its credit card members.
The headline split The left frames it as "American Express posted stronger-than-expected profit but the stock was slipping". The right frames it as "American Express rides a boom in Platinum cards to its strongest spending growth in years".

American Express posted stronger-than-expected profit but the stock was slipping

The card company posted second-quarter earnings of $4.53 per share, up 11% from a year ago, as card member spending rose 9%
